Job Description:

Collaborates with teams across Consumer Access, Pre-Access, and other Revenue Cycle functional areas to translate operational and business requirements to end users and leaders. Provides ongoing subject matter expert support to guide complex initiatives for applications used by Consumer Access and Pre-Access departments, recommending optimal system and technology usage. Assists with implementation and testing of Consumer Access and Pre-Access applications, ensuring automations, dashboards, and other tools provide accurate and usable data. Identifies opportunities and provides actionable recommendations for process improvement in support of strategic initiatives related to Consumer Access and Pre-Access business processes and applications. Coordinates and leads feedback and calibration sessions with team members and managers to leverage quality management tools for training and coaching. Collaborates with Corporate Education, Vendor Management, Project Management, and other Revenue Cycle leaders to provide operational support during strategic Revenue Cycle initiatives. Works with Education and Quality Audit teams to assess trends, perform root cause analysis, and recommend process and technology enhancements. Provides recommendations on policies and procedures to improve employee efficiency and consumer experience, prioritizing and addressing the most critical issues. Creates and provides continuing education and leadership development materials, supporting and training customers, vendors, and internal/external stakeholders on revenue cycle applications and processes. Participates in department initiatives and meetings, contributing to the overall success of the team. Other duties as assigned.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
